This study investigates the mechanisms through which peer effects, attitudes toward sports policies, and formal institutional factors influence college students' intentions to engage in normative sports behaviors. The goal is to provide theoretical insights and practical guidance for enhancing students' adherence to normative sports conduct, fostering positive behavioral habits, and promoting holistic physical and mental development. A total of 2,340 college students from 20 universities across China participated in a structured questionnaire survey. Data analysis was conducted using AMOS 28.0, SPSS 24.0, and the PROCESS macro. The findings reveal that: (1) Peer effects are significantly and positively associated with students' intentions to engage in normative sports behaviors; (2) Attitudes toward sports policies partially mediate the relationship between peer effects and normative sports behavior intentions; and (3) Formal institutional factors significantly moderate the relationships between peer effects and normative behavior intentions, peer effects and policy attitudes, and policy attitudes and behavioral intentions. Moreover, the strength of these positive associations increases as a formal institution becomes more robust. The study concludes that peer effects influence students' behavioral intentions directly and indirectly via policy attitudes. The moderating role of formal institutions underscores the need for a combination approach of internal and external collaboration, integrating peer effects, policy attitude cultivation, and institutional development, to more effectively foster good sports behaviors among college students.
